Understanding the N76e003 Datasheet and Its Crucial Role

The N76e003 Datasheet is more than just a document; it's the definitive guide to the N76e003 microcontroller, a powerful 8-bit device from Nuvoton Technology. This datasheet provides an exhaustive overview of the chip's architecture, features, electrical characteristics, and operational parameters. For engineers, hobbyists, and students alike, it's the foundational resource for successful integration and application development. Without consulting the N76e003 Datasheet, developers risk misinterpreting capabilities, leading to design flaws or inefficient implementations.

The N76e003 Datasheet details a wealth of information, crucial for understanding how to interface with and program the microcontroller. This includes:

  • Core Features : Understanding the Central Processing Unit (CPU), memory organization (Flash, RAM), and clock system.
  • Peripherals : Details on integrated peripherals such as timers, Analog-to-Digital Converters (ADCs), communication interfaces (UART, SPI, I2C), and GPIOs.
  • Electrical Specifications : Crucial voltage and current requirements, operating temperature ranges, and power consumption figures.
  • Pin Configurations : A clear layout of each pin and its alternate functions, essential for accurate board design.

Here's a glimpse into the kind of data you'll find:

Parameter Typical Value Units
Operating Voltage 2.4V - 5.5V V
Flash Memory 16KB Bytes
RAM 1KB Bytes
